用户访问数据库有以下要求:1、必须具备必要的权限和访问证书、2、应了解和遵守数据的使用规定、3、必须使用适当的查询语言、4、应具备基本的数据库操作和管理知识、5、需要关注和提升数据的安全性和保密性、6、在使用数据库时,应注重数据的完整性和一致性。
在这些要求中,必须具备必要的权限和访问证书尤为重要。数据库是存储和管理大量数据的重要工具,而数据安全性是其最重要的属性之一。因此,任何想要访问数据库的用户,无论是数据库管理员还是普通用户,都必须具有相应的权限和访问证书。这些权限和证书主要是用来确认用户的身份和授权范围,防止未经授权的访问和操作,确保数据库的安全性。而这些权限和证书通常由数据库管理员进行分配和管理,根据用户的角色和需要,给予不同的权限和证书,比如只读、读写、管理等。
I. DATABASE PERMISSIONS AND ACCESS CERTIFICATES
在数据库中,权限和访问证书是非常重要的安全机制。它们主要用于确认用户的身份和防止未经授权的访问和操作。具有不同权限和证书的用户,可以执行不同的操作,例如,只读用户只能查看数据,不能修改;具有读写权限的用户可以查看和修改数据;而数据库管理员则可以执行所有操作,包括创建和删除数据库,分配和管理用户权限等。因此,用户在访问数据库时,必须具备必要的权限和访问证书。
II. UNDERSTANDING AND FOLLOWING DATA USAGE RULES
用户在访问数据库时,还必须了解和遵守数据的使用规定。这些规定可能包括数据的访问、使用、共享、存储、备份和销毁等方面的规定。例如,用户可能需要遵守公司的数据保密政策,不能将数据泄露给未经授权的人员。或者,用户可能需要遵守数据的备份和存储规定,确保数据的安全和完整性。
III. USING THE APPROPRIATE QUERY LANGUAGE
数据库通常使用特定的查询语言,如SQL,来管理和操作数据。因此,用户在访问数据库时,必须使用适当的查询语言。不同的数据库可能使用不同的查询语言,用户需要了解和熟悉所使用的数据库的查询语言。此外,用户还需要了解查询语言的基本语法和结构,以便正确地执行查询和操作。
IV. BASIC DATABASE OPERATION AND MANAGEMENT KNOWLEDGE
用户在访问数据库时,还需要具备基本的数据库操作和管理知识。这包括了解数据库的基本结构和组成,如表、字段、记录、索引等;了解数据库的基本操作,如查询、插入、更新、删除等;以及了解数据库的基本管理任务,如备份、恢复、优化等。这些知识可以帮助用户更有效地使用数据库,避免错误的操作。
V. DATA SECURITY AND CONFIDENTIALITY
数据安全性和保密性是数据库最重要的属性之一。用户在访问数据库时,需要关注和提升数据的安全性和保密性。这可能包括使用安全的连接方式,如SSL,来保护数据传输的安全;使用强密码,来保护账户的安全;以及使用加密技术,来保护数据的保密性。此外,用户还需要了解和遵守相关的数据安全和保密规定,如数据保密政策、数据安全法规等。
VI. MAINTAINING DATA INTEGRITY AND CONSISTENCY
数据库的数据完整性和一致性是其最重要的质量属性之一。用户在访问数据库时,需要注意保持数据的完整性和一致性。这可能包括使用事务,来保证操作的原子性和一致性;使用约束,来保证数据的完整性;以及使用触发器和存储过程,来自动执行某些操作,保证数据的一致性。
相关问答FAQs:
1. 用户访问数据库有哪些要求?
- 权限要求: 用户在访问数据库时,需要具备相应的访问权限。数据库通常会为不同的用户分配不同的权限,例如只读权限、读写权限等。用户需要确保自己具备所需的权限才能进行数据库访问。
- 身份验证要求: 用户在访问数据库时,需要进行身份验证,以确保其身份的合法性。常见的身份验证方式包括用户名和密码、证书等。用户需要提供正确的身份验证信息才能成功访问数据库。
- 网络连接要求: 用户访问数据库需要通过网络进行数据传输。因此,用户需要确保自己拥有可靠的网络连接,以避免数据传输过程中出现断连或延迟等问题。
- 数据格式要求: 用户访问数据库时,需要了解数据库中存储的数据格式,以便正确地读取和处理数据。不同的数据库系统可能采用不同的数据格式,用户需要根据数据库的要求进行数据格式转换或处理。
- 性能要求: 用户在访问数据库时,通常会对数据库性能有一定的要求,例如响应时间、并发处理能力等。用户需要根据自己的需求选择合适的数据库系统,并进行性能优化,以提高访问效率和响应速度。
2. 如何满足用户对数据库访问的要求?
- 授权管理: 数据库管理员可以通过授权管理来分配用户的访问权限,确保每个用户只能访问其具备权限的数据。同时,数据库管理员还可以设置访问控制策略,限制用户对敏感数据的访问。
- 身份验证机制: 数据库系统通常提供多种身份验证机制,如用户名和密码、证书等。用户可以根据自己的需求选择合适的身份验证方式,并确保提供正确的身份验证信息。
- 网络优化: 用户可以通过优化网络连接来提高数据库访问的效率和稳定性。例如,使用高速网络、优化网络拓扑结构、提高带宽等方法,可以减少数据传输的延迟和丢包率,提高访问速度。
- 数据格式转换: 用户可以根据数据库的要求进行数据格式转换,以确保正确地读取和处理数据。数据库系统通常提供了数据转换工具或接口,用户可以根据自己的需求进行数据格式转换。
- 性能调优: 用户可以通过优化数据库的配置和索引设计等方法来提高数据库的性能。例如,合理设置缓存大小、调整查询语句、优化数据库表结构等,可以减少数据库的响应时间和提高并发处理能力。
3. 用户访问数据库的常见问题及解决方法有哪些?
- 访问权限问题: 如果用户无法访问数据库,可能是由于权限不足导致的。解决方法是联系数据库管理员,请求相应的访问权限。
- 身份验证问题: 如果用户无法通过身份验证,可能是由于提供的身份验证信息不正确或过期。解决方法是确认提供的身份验证信息是否正确,并更新或重新申请身份验证信息。
- 网络连接问题: 如果用户在访问数据库时遇到网络连接问题,可能是由于网络故障或配置错误导致的。解决方法是检查网络连接是否正常,排除网络故障,并根据需要重新配置网络连接。
- 数据格式问题: 如果用户无法正确读取或处理数据库中的数据,可能是由于数据格式不匹配导致的。解决方法是了解数据库中数据的格式要求,进行数据格式转换或处理。
- 性能问题: 如果用户在访问数据库时遇到性能问题,可能是由于数据库配置不当或查询语句设计不合理导致的。解决方法是优化数据库的配置和索引设计,调整查询语句,以提高数据库的性能和响应速度。
文章标题:用户访问数据库有什么要求,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/2880939